Other attractions near Whitehorse Wildland Provincial Park

A clear mountain lake surrounded by rocky shores and dense forests.

Medicine Lake

8.8/10 (90 reviews)
Visit this tranquil lake with its mysterious underground chasms, where the water seems to disappear by magic.
See properties
A turquoise lake surrounded by dense forests and snow-capped mountains under a clear blue sky.

Maligne Lake

9.4/10 (1,795 reviews)
Whether you cruise the clear waters of this lake, or hike in the surrounding slopes, you’ll be guaranteed some of the most iconic views in the Canadian Rockies.
